Forging Knives out of Local Wood, Horns, and Car Bearings in Bhutan
In this video, I talk about my recent two-month long stay in Bhutan where I held another knife-making workshop for local knife-makers. In the process of demonstrating some techniques, I created a collection of knives using local steel and materials: a san-mai laminate Gyuto and two san-mai laminate cleavers.

    Very nice craftsmanship much respect for what you do. Especially in regards to utilizing the indigenous materials. How does 1084 compare to 1095 high carbon steel?

    • @baleteblades
      @baleteblades Před 19 dny

      Thank you!!! They’re very similar! I’d say 1084 is simpler to work with because 1095 is more sensitive to temperature. *more in depth answer is that 1084 doesn’t leave a lot of carbon to form carbides like 1095 does, so it’s much less sensitive to temperature and doesn’t require a temp soak like 1095 does. 1095 is much closer to 52100 than it is to 1084 :) Hope that answers the question!
